Putin says he hopes there will be no need to use nuclear weapons in Ukraine

Vladimir Putin stated nuclear weapons use in Ukraine is unnecessary and hopefully will remain so. He affirmed Russia's capacity to achieve its goals in Ukraine. A 72-hour ceasefire for Victory Day was declared, but Volodymyr Zelenskyy dismissed it as a tactic. He proposed a 30-day pause. Meanwhile, Kyiv faced a Russian drone attack, wounding eleven, including children.
